**Action Item 4: Migrate nightly cron jobs to Pellwork**

Owner: platform team. The outage showed that cron jobs on the Brindlemoor host have no retry logic or alerting. Each job must be rewritten as a Pellwork workflow with explicit timeouts and failure notifications. Please migrate jobs one at a time, leaving the cron entry disabled but in place for two weeks as a fallback. The migration checklist and sign-off process are documented on the internal page below.

dashboard of tahop-fahof = https://harbor.tolvaqnet.example/secrets/merge_requests/board/issue/merge_requests/pipeline/secrets/ecb30ed86a55c001a77f6cb9

Ticket: Config drift on cold-storage archiver (Fernwick cluster)

During last night's sweep, the Glacierbin archiver on Fernwick was found running with retention and throttle settings that differ from what source control declares. Three buckets were archived a week early as a result. Please do not hand-patch the node; redeploy from the manifest instead. For comparison, the intended configuration is as follows.

service settings:
[pelius]
port = 5432
team = praius
host = pelius.crelvoforge.internal
region = upper-4
access_code = ac_8f224d
timeout_ms = 2000

Handover note — Paylune retry service. Welcome aboard. Each payment retry must reuse the idempotency key minted on the first attempt; keys live in the Korvax store with a 48-hour TTL. Never regenerate a key mid-retry or you'll double-charge. Dasha owns the reconciliation job if anything looks off. To unlock the staging vault, use the recovery passphrase below.

vault phrase of fahog-yajog = frawyn-jordor-casael-gormir-olieth-julmir